Output df58ab14580105b60de4ea72fbd23c8ea67488c7dd184a10644bc2fa4ae55e85:1

value
34026000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ada48e966cefb457bf5795033615916bb056f81b OP_EQUAL
address
A8GQhCKeBtyLrUyskmDqaeecNjsbz24psg
transaction
df58ab14580105b60de4ea72fbd23c8ea67488c7dd184a10644bc2fa4ae55e85